C-Tecnics to Support Live Dive Tank Demonstrations at Seawork 2026

C-Tecnics will support live diving demonstrations at Seawork 2026, taking place from 9 to 11 June at Mayflower Park in Southampton, United Kingdom.

Exhibiting alongside the Association of Diving Contractors UK & Ireland (ADC) on Stand U10, C-Tecnics will provide the underwater video, diver communications and recording systems used throughout the Seawork Dive Tank programme.

One of the exhibition’s key attractions, the Dive Tank hosts a varied programme of live demonstrations including diver rescue procedures, helmet testing, lift bag operations, inspection activities, ROV demonstrations and underwater tooling showcases.

Supporting Live Underwater Demonstrations

Throughout the three-day programme, visitors will be able to follow live underwater activity using C-Tecnics systems designed for commercial diving and subsea operations.

The setup includes the CV2 C-Vision Diver Video & Communications System, CT3015 Compact Colour Camera and CT4006 Mini LED Light, delivering live underwater video, clear diver communications and recording capabilities throughout the demonstrations.

By providing a real-time view beneath the surface, the system allows visitors to see equipment operating in a practical environment rather than as a static display.

Diver Recovery Equipment in Action

C-Tecnics diver recovery equipment will also feature throughout the Dive Tank programme, supporting live rescue demonstrations during the exhibition.

Equipment includes the HA015 JOK Diver Recovery Jacket, HS040 Spreader Bar, Weak Link and MS001 Backstabber Knife, demonstrating practical solutions designed to support safe and controlled diver recovery operations.

Alongside the live demonstrations, visitors will also be able to explore a range of C-Tecnics underwater video, communications, lighting, umbilical and diver recovery solutions on Stand U10, including prototype AGA communications equipment currently undergoing industry evaluation.

About Seawork 2026

Seawork is Europe’s leading commercial marine and workboat exhibition, bringing together professionals from commercial diving, marine engineering, offshore renewables, vessel operations, ports and marine technology.

The event attracts visitors from more than 60 countries and provides a platform for manufacturers, contractors and operators to showcase the latest innovations and technologies through live demonstrations, technical discussions and networking opportunities.
